About Lili Youngblood

As the former 2013 board president of the REALTORS of Greater Augusta, Lili Youngblood is a multi-faceted individual with an eye for detail. Lili has been recognized multiple times with the customer service award for good reason: with over one thousand satisfied clients, buyers and sellers can rest assured that Lili will work hard to negotiate the best deal for them.  Bi-lingual, highly accredited, and with 28 years of experience, you can take comfort in knowing that Lili wants to make your buying or selling experience the most pleasant it can be. Lili says that while awards might show you that she is competent, that’s not what it’s all about for her.  “What matters most are the people who put their trust in me. How would I take care of a family member’s real estate transaction?  How about my best friend’s?  Well, that’s exactly how I take care of my clients.” 

Lili’s philosophy is simple: clients come first. She pledges to be in constant communication with her clients, keeping them fully informed throughout the entire buying or selling process. She believes that if you’re not left with an amazing experience, she hasn’t done her job. She doesn’t measure success through achievements or awards, but through the satisfaction of her clients.
